On Thu, Feb 23, 2017 at 04:37:00PM +1100, Suraj Jitindar Singh wrote: > On Thu, 2017-02-23 at 13:09 +1100, David Gibson wrote: > > Accesses to the hashed page table (HPT) are complicated by the fact > > that > > the HPT could be in one of three places: > > 1) Within guest memory - when we're emulating a full guest CPU at > > the > > hardware level (e.g. powernv, mac99, g3beige) > > 2) Within qemu, but outside guest memory - when we're emulating > > user and > > supervisor instructions within TCG, but instead of emulating > > the CPU's hypervisor mode, we just emulate a hypervisor's > > behaviour > > (pseries in TCG) > > 3) Within KVM - a pseries machine using KVM acceleration. Mostly > > accesses to the HPT are handled by KVM, but there are a few > > cases > > where qemu needs to access it via a special fd for the purpose. > > Should you clarify that this is the case for KVM-HV with KVM-PR the > same as (2)?
Ah, good idea. > > > > > In order to batch accesses to the fd in case (3), we use a somewhat > > awkward > > ppc_hash64_start_access() / ppc_hash64_stop_access() pair, which for > > case > > (3) reads / releases a whole PTEG from the kernel. For cases (1) & > > (2) > > it just returns an address value. The actual HPTE load helpers then > > need > > to interpret the returned token differently in the 3 cases. > > > > This patch keeps the same basic structure, but simplfiies the > > details. > > First start_access() / stop_access() are renamed to get_pteg() and > > put_pteg() to make their operation more obvious. Second, read_pteg() > > Here you say they've been renamed to get/put/read_pteg, but in the code > they're called map/unmap_hptes and it looks like map_hptes does both > the get and the read? Oops, I'll update. > > > now > > always returns a qemu pointer, which can always be used in the same > > way > > by the load_hpte() helpers. In case (1) it comes from > > address_space_map() > > in case (2) directly from qemu's HPT buffer and in case (3) from a > > temporary buffer read from the KVM fd. > > > > While we're at it, make things a bit more consistent in terms of > > types and > > variable names: avoid variables named 'index' (it shadows index(3) > > which > > can lead to confusing results), use 'hwaddr ptex' for HPTE indices > > and > > uint64_t for each of the HPTE words, use ptex throughout the call > > stack > > instead of pte_offset in some places (we still need that at the > > bottom > > layer, but nowhere else). > > > > Signed-off-by: David Gibson <da...@gibson.dropbear.id.au> > > Other than the commit message: > > Reviewed-by: Suraj Jitindar Singh <sjitindarsi...@gmail.com> > > > --- > > hw/ppc/spapr_hcall.c | 36 +++++++++--------- > > target/ppc/cpu.h | 3 +- > > target/ppc/kvm.c | 25 ++++++------- > > target/ppc/kvm_ppc.h | 43 ++++++++++------------ > > target/ppc/mmu-hash64.c | 98 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++------------- > > ---------- > > target/ppc/mmu-hash64.h | 46 ++++++++--------------- > > 6 files changed, 119 insertions(+), 132 deletions(-) > > > > diff --git a/hw/ppc/spapr_hcall.c b/hw/ppc/spapr_hcall.c > > index 3298a14..fd961b5 100644 > > --- a/hw/ppc/spapr_hcall.c > > +++ b/hw/ppc/spapr_hcall.c > > @@ -84,7 +84,7 @@ static target_ulong h_enter(PowerPCCPU *cpu, > > sPAPRMachineState *spapr, > > unsigned apshift;
